The cheapest way to get from Ypres to Le Touquet-Paris-Plage is to drive which costs €17 - €26 and takes 1h 56m.
The fastest way to get from Ypres to Le Touquet-Paris-Plage is to drive which takes 1h 56m and costs €17 - €26.
No, there is no direct train from Ypres to Le Touquet-Paris-Plage. However, there are services departing from Ypres and arriving at Etaples Le Touquet via Courtrai and Lille Europe.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 10m.
The distance between Ypres and Le Touquet-Paris-Plage is 230 km. The road distance is 115.4 km.
The best way to get from Ypres to Le Touquet-Paris-Plage without a car is to train which takes 5h 10m and costs €35 - €80.
It takes approximately 5h 10m to get from Ypres to Le Touquet-Paris-Plage, including transfers.
